Output fa232dd7e8d76d6bfc0bdabbe59b93c0316ec87aa2d66acfddca68b81b47ae41:159

value
1621604
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 00a21fc592e37136f96f139cfc23f494610e73d8 OP_EQUALVERIFY OP_CHECKSIG
address
114MDafw8TpetMrNLh6eNQEgDRCZ5wXZQD
transaction
fa232dd7e8d76d6bfc0bdabbe59b93c0316ec87aa2d66acfddca68b81b47ae41
confirmations
174102
spent
true